Step 1
Ideal slow cooker size: 4-Quart.
Step 2
In a bowl, combine the ground beef, rice, egg and seasonings in a bowl and mix well.
Step 3
Roll mixture into 16 balls (aka "porcupines").
Step 4
Place meatballs in the slow cooker, trying to keep them in a single layer if you can.
Step 5
Pour on the soup. (If you are using a condensed soup you'll want to thin it with 1/2 can of water before pouring on.)
Step 6
Cover and cook on LOW for 4 to 6 hours, or until the meatballs are cooked through.
Step 7
Alternatively, you can place the meatballs in a single layer in a casserole dish, pour on the soup and bake in a 350F degree oven for about 1 hour, until the meatballs are cooked through and soup/sauce is bubbly.
